Clinical Application
This double-ended hand retractor is intended to provide broad, right-angle exposure of soft tissue and wound edges during open surgical procedures. It is commonly used in general and abdominal cases for retraction of subcutaneous tissue, fascia and organ margins where controlled manual retraction is required. The two blade sizes accommodate both superficial and deeper pockets, allowing an assistant or surgeon to maintain consistent exposure without frequent instrument changes.
Design & Configuration
The double-ended geometry places two right-angle flat blades on a single shaft so the operator can quickly select a smaller or larger blade without exchanging instruments. Right-angle blades present a low-profile working face that helps distribute retraction force across a broader area, improving visualization while reducing focal pressure on tissue. The 26 cm overall length offers reach into deeper wounds while preserving tactile control for precise retraction maneuvers.
Instrument Specifications
- Instrument type: Retractor
- Pattern / model: Richardson-Eastman
- Configuration: Double-ended, right-angle flat blades
- Blade sizes: 28x20 mm and 36x28 mm
- Overall length: 26 cm
- Typical use: Manual soft-tissue and wound-edge retraction
Material & Construction
Constructed from corrosion-resistant stainless steel to withstand repeated sterilization and clinical use. Smooth, solid blade faces facilitate atraumatic retraction and straightforward cleaning. Designed and finished for reusable surgical service.
